Controlling Planning & Reporting Analyst
The Financial Planning & Controlling Analyst is a key role and acts as Finance Business Partners to management by performing financial planning & controlling activities, providing in-depth financial analysis for the purpose of strategic and tactical decision-making.
The Analyst demonstrates a sound understanding of business performance drivers and builds plans, tracks results and performs analytics to deepen understanding for decision-making processes to steer the business. Hence, the Analyst participates in business planning & execution meetings providing sound financial & business performance reports.
Further, this position acts as key support function for the Regional Finance Controller, with regards to preparing Budgets, business information and presentations for purposes of providing guidance tracking performance for reporting in Monthly Business Review meetings, Sales meetings, Pricing Board, etc.

Financial Planning
- Translates business strategy into a business plan. Identifies key business drivers and translates them to business KPIs to facilitate decision making.
- Has good insight into Category value chain and business model. Is able to connect the linkages between input drivers and outcomes.
- Has thorough understanding of sector and competitor performance. Understands macro-economic situation and regulations and is able to quantify impact on business results.
- Reports on unit performance and provides insight to the leadership team on areas of performance and under-performance.
- Obtains and integrates cross-functional inputs to develop rolling forecasts for the region. Custodian of the planning and forecasting process.
- Co-ordinates the annual budgeting process.
Financial Controlling
- Understands accounting principles and standards (IFRS, GAAPs).
- Issues accounting guidelines and data collection templates in response to changes in accounting standards and internal reporting needs
- Defines and implements consolidation processes to adhere to statutory and management requirements.
- Manage financial closing processes, every month, quarter and year.
- Prepares local financial statements (P&L, Balance sheet, Cash flow, Notes to Accounts).
- Ensure adherence to audit requirements including co-ordination with statutory auditors.
- Ensure adherence to governance and compliance requirements in respect of accounts, reporting and audit.
- Defines risk control matrix leading to establishment of revenue assurance (RA) controls across all revenue streams. Constantly updates this matrix to prioritise high value, high risk areas.
- Documents the standard Finance processes, procedures, work instructions and SLAs.
- Translates exceptions into financial impact, and communicates the value at risk to management and initiates cross-functional actions to plug gaps.
- Identifies revenue / cost-saving opportunities for business based on insight into the company’s service delivery and revenue- generation and cost models.
